Record 20.62 lakh tourist arrivals in Shimla, says DC

Shimla, May 5 (UNI) A record number of over 20.62 lakh tourists have already visited Himachal Pradesh's state capital Shimla from April to December this financial year as against 10.63 lakh during 2004-05, Shimla Deputy Commissioner Tarun Kapoor today said.

The number of tourists visiting the town had swelled to 20.62 lakh during the first nine months of 2006-07 in comparison to 18.22 lakh during the last financial year, he said, while chairing a meeting of Shimla Hotel Association and Beopar Mandal here.

The meeting had been called to review the arrangements made for the tourists in view of the summer rush to Shimla town and to ensure that the tourists were not put to any inconvenience during their stay here.

Mr Kapoor said in order to make the stay of the tourists comfortable and memorable, the district administration would create 13 additional parking lots during the summer season.

Besides, a special taxi service would continue to ply between Shimla Bus Stand and Central Telegraph Office from 0830 hrs to 2230 hrs, he said.

He said the hotel association's demand for allowing taxi service to ply between National Museum via bus stand and Chotta Shimla to Shimla Club would also be taken up with the state government.

Besides, he said, the administration would also try to impress upon the government to increase the timings of the lift from the present 2200 hrs to 2300 hrs.

The Shimla DC also urged upon the hotel and restaurant owners of the town to collect water from the selected water sources that have been identified by the Shimla Municipal Corporation only as water in several sources was found not fit for human consumption.
